About May in Norco

May in Norco strikes a deliberate balance between walkability and suburban ease. With a walk score of 68 and median home values near $426k, the neighborhood attracts young families, first-time buyers, and professionals seeking accessible daily errands without sacrificing space. The community is younger on average (median age 31.8), with 45% of households including children and a median household income of $94.6k, reflecting a stable, growth-oriented demographic.

Living in May, Norco

Daily life in May centers on local retail strips, parks, and family-oriented activities. Groceries are steps away at Cardenas or Stater Bros., while coffee runs to Starbucks or Tastea punctuate morning routines. Additionally, the Riverwalk complex offers jogging trails, a dedicated dog park, and weekend farmers markets, making outdoor recreation accessible without a car. Summer concerts and neighborhood street fairs draw families, though Norco's broader entertainment scene, including Hamilton Terrace events, requires a short drive.

Schools Near May, Norco

May sits within the Alvord Unified School District, which operates strong elementary and middle school options nearby. Promenade Elementary (score 58) and S. Christa Mcauliffe Elementary (score 41) serve kindergarten through fifth grade, while Ysmael Villegas Middle (score 41.5) handles sixth through eighth.

Commute from May

Additionally, may's location in central Norco places jobs and urban amenities within reasonable driving distance. A personal vehicle is essential; transit options are limited, though 75.5% of the neighborhood commutes by car.

Downtown Riverside (job centers, dining)
Drive: 12 to 18 minutesTransit: 45 to 60 minutes
San Bernardino (manufacturing, logistics hubs)
Drive: 22 to 28 minutesTransit: limited
Ontario International Airport
Drive: 35 to 45 minutesTransit: 90+ minutes (limited)

Additionally, riverside Transit Agency (RTA) local buses serve May with modest frequency; most residents rely on personal vehicles for daily commutes and errands.
